What we drew from this source

The claims Via News extracted from this document. We point to the source; we don't replace it.

  • American consumers are increasingly favoring flexible, cost-effective transportation solutions that eliminate the burdens of ownership

    80% confidence
  • The Global Vehicle Subscription Services Market was valued at USD 4.7 billion in 2024

    80% confidence
  • The multi-brand segment generated a substantial share in 2024

    80% confidence
  • Consumers are shifting away from traditional car ownership toward more flexible and convenient mobility options fueled by a desire to avoid long-term financial and maintenance commitments

    80% confidence
  • The OEM segment in the vehicle subscription services market held a notable share in 2024

    80% confidence
  • The Global Vehicle Subscription Services Market is estimated to grow at a CAGR of 13.6% to reach USD 16 billion by 2034

    80% confidence
  • The U.S. vehicle subscription services market is projected to surpass USD 5 billion in the next five years

    80% confidence
